Transaction 7aad30664abee206f582b8ff9ca39765e4dc9129a0a94ea6773325c4c5715e02
1 Input
1 Output
-
7aad30664abee206f582b8ff9ca39765e4dc9129a0a94ea6773325c4c5715e02:0
- value
- 3809623
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0491890089ae1f5a2bf688aa32ada23e546b5818 OP_EQUAL
- address
- 327AyGhqVPVqpnboU57wpXsH2kBRzxmrfq